Internal Medicine/Geriatrics Post-Acute Care Physician
BJC Medical Group | West County Medical Associates

St. Louis, Missouri

Join a Leading Academic-Community Health System

BJC Medical Group is seeking a Board Certified/Board Eligible Internal Medicine or Geriatrics Physician to join West County Medical Associates in a Post-Acute Care role serving patients throughout the West St. Louis County region.

As part of BJC HealthCare, physicians benefit from the clinical excellence, resources, and collaborative environment of one of the nation's premier integrated healthcare systems. This opportunity is academically affiliated with Washington University School of Medicine and offers strong connections to Barnes-Jewish West County Hospital, an extension of the nationally recognized Barnes-Jewish Hospital network.

This position is ideal for a physician who enjoys managing medically complex adult and geriatric patients, collaborating across the continuum of care, and making a meaningful impact on patient outcomes during critical transitions from hospital to post-acute settings.

Practice Overview

The Post-Acute Care Physician will provide comprehensive medical care within skilled nursing facilities, rehabilitation centers, assisted living communities, and long-term care facilities. Working alongside an interdisciplinary care team, the physician will focus on improving quality outcomes, reducing readmissions, and ensuring seamless transitions of care.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ide admission, follow-up, and transitional care services in post-acute and long-term care settings.
  • Manage acute and chronic medical conditions in adult and geriatric populations.
  • Coordinate care transitions from Barnes-Jewish West County Hospital, Barnes-Jewish Hospital, and other referring facilities.
  • Collaborate with advanced practice providers, nursing staff, therapists, social workers, and specialists.
  • Participate in interdisciplinary care conferences and family meetings.
  • Conduct goals-of-care and advance care planning discussions.
  • Drive quality initiatives focused on reducing avoidable hospitalizations and improving patient outcomes.
  • Complete accurate and timely EMR documentation.
  • Foster strong relationships with facility partners and referral sources across the community.
